How to Write 襞 (bì)

襞 (bì) means "fold or pleat" in Chinese. It has 19 strokes with the radical 衣. Difficulty: 4.2/5.

19 strokes Radical: 衣 Difficulty: 4.2/5

fold or pleat

Common Words with 襞

褶襞 zhě bì
fold; pleat
襞积 bì jī
Pleats or folds in clothing
胃襞 wèi bì
Gastric folds

Example Sentences

裙摆上有很多褶襞。

qún bǎi shàng yǒu hěn duō zhě bì

There are many pleats on the hem of the skirt.

这种布料容易产生襞积。

zhè zhǒng bù liào róng yì chǎn shēng bì jī

This fabric tends to pleat or wrinkle easily.

医生检查了胃襞。

yī shēng jiǎn chá le wèi bì

The doctor examined the gastric folds.
